Default Fuel and Service Apps

I've seen some recent posts about calculating mileage and thought I would share some great apps that I use.

For the iPhone, Car Care is the absolute best. You can track your mileage and all your service dates. I actually put my entire Rover history in the app and can send it to any email address as needed. It's not free, but well worth the cost of a few dollars. Can be used with multiple vehicles as well. I actually don't have my iPhone in service anymore, but I still keep it in the car for this app only.

For my new Droid, I found a free app called Fuel Log. It's not even close to the iPhone app, but it keeps accurate mileage stats.
